Nihan Katırcı
About
Nihan Katırcı has authored 24 papers that have received a total of 564 indexed citations.
This includes 23 papers in Nuclear and High Energy Physics, 18 papers in Astronomy and Astrophysics and 1 paper in Organic Chemistry. The topics of these papers are Black Holes and Theoretical Physics (21 papers), Cosmology and Gravitation Theories (18 papers) and Particle physics theoretical and experimental studies (5 papers). Nihan Katırcı is often cited by papers focused on Black Holes and Theoretical Physics (21 papers), Cosmology and Gravitation Theories (18 papers) and Particle physics theoretical and experimental studies (5 papers) and collaborates with scholars based in Türkiye, India and Spain. Nihan Katırcı's co-authors include Özgür Akarsu, K. Azizi, Suresh Kumar, J. Alberto Vázquez and Rafael C. Nunes and has published in prestigious journals such as Journal of High Energy Physics, Physical review. D and The European Physical Journal C.
